U can get universal wax that is kinda like prep wax for your base. its better to use this because if not, ull have to buy wax for different temperatures which becomes expensive and annoying.
Dont use rub on.. its used for racers. they rub it on right before their race and it last about 1 or 2 runs.
My opinion, when base starts looking white ish, put universal wax on with an iron, once its dry, scrap it off with a plastic scrapper, and if u really want to do a good job, purchase a rough and a soft brush (Swix make a nice rough brush (white) and soft brush (blue).) After scrapping, pass the white brush, then the blue one. this will really give your skis a nice finish.
